MEMORANDUM

 

TO:                      Nyasha Smith, Secretary to the Council

               

FROM:               Phil Mendelson, Chairman

                                                               

DATE:                August 3, 2021

 

RE:                       Notice of intent to move an amendment in the nature of a substitute at the August 3, 2021 Additional Legislative Meeting

 

This memorandum serves as notice that I intend to move an amendment in the nature of a substitute (ANS) for each of the following measures at the Additional Legislative Meeting scheduled for Tuesday, August 3, 2021:

 

  • PR 24-270, the Fiscal Year 2021 Revised Local Budget Emergency Declaration Resolution of 2021
  • Bill 24-279, the Fiscal Year 2021 Revised Local Budget Emergency Act of 2021

 

The ANS for the emergency measure includes several technical changes developed in concert with the Council’s Office of the General Counsel, the Office of the Chief Financial Officer, and the Executive. In addition, the following changes were made:

 

  • Various adjustments to agency budgets in FY 2021 as requested by the Mayor, including federal payments for COVID relief that were not previously moved in Bill 24-277 or 24-360, and adjustments incorporated into the Fiscal Year 2022 Budget and Financial Plan as approved by the Council at first reading on July 20, 2021.
  • Requests included in the Mayor’s June 25, 2021 errata letter, including authorizing language for CAFR surplus use; COVID-19 economic recovery initiatives related to non-health occupational licensing, corporate filing report forgiveness, business fee reductions; repealing the pay freeze instituted in the FY 2021 Budget Support Act; and approving the District government employee pay schedules. 
  • Two grants previously included in the Fiscal Year 2022 Budget Support Act of 2021, approved by the Council at first reading on July 20, 2021, one for HVAC replacement at PR Harris Educational Center and another for a children’s museum, have been moved to Bill 24-279 because the funds are needed in FY 2021.
  • Capital project reallocations and designated fund transfers, previously included in the Fiscal Year 2022 Budget Support Act of 2021, approved by the Council at first reading on July 20, 2021, have been updated and moved to this bill to ensure that they take effect expeditiously.
  • At the request of the Mayor, $163,000 has been added to the Metropolitan Police Department to allow the hiring of 20 new sworn officers.

 

The ANS for PR 24-270 simply revises that emergency declaration resolution in light of the changes made to the underlying emergency bill.
